What is Creatine?
Creatine is a naturally occurring compound found in your muscles, making up about 95% of the creatine in your body. It’s involved in the production of ATP (adenosine triphosphate), the primary energy carrier in cells, which is especially important during high-intensity, short-duration activities like sprinting or lifting heavy weights. You don’t need to worry—creatine is not a steroid! Your body produces creatine naturally, primarily in the liver, kidneys, and pancreas, from amino acids (arginine, glycine, and methionine).
You can also get creatine from dietary sources like fish (herring, salmon) and red meat (beef, pork). However, the amount you get from food alone is relatively small, and supplementation is often needed to maximize benefits.

For Cognitive and Nerve Function:
Creatine plays a role in energy production in the brain, too. Research has shown that it can enhance cognitive function, particularly in tasks requiring short-term memory and quick thinking. A 2003 study published in Neuropsychology found that creatine supplementation improved cognitive performance in individuals undergoing sleep deprivation. Additionally, creatine has shown potential in neuroprotection, suggesting it may support nerve function in conditions like Parkinson’s disease and muscular dystrophy.
For Older Adults:
As we age, our muscle mass naturally decreases, a condition known as sarcopenia. This muscle loss can lead to weakness and a reduced ability to perform everyday tasks. Creatine supplementation has been shown to help counteract this effect, improving muscle strength and function in older adults. A 2017 study in The Journal of Gerontology found that creatine supplementation, in combination with resistance training, significantly enhanced strength and physical performance in older individuals.
Addressing Common Myths and Concerns
Weight Gain: Is It Really a Concern?
One common side effect of creatine supplementation is weight gain, but it’s important to understand that this weight gain is due to increased fluid retention in muscle cells, not fat gain. This intracellular water can help improve muscle function and create a more anabolic (muscle-building) environment, promoting further muscle growth and strength gains. So, this type of weight gain is generally considered beneficial, not detrimental.
Does Creatine Cause Hair Loss?
Many people wonder if creatine can cause hair loss, given some reports and concerns surrounding dihydrotestosterone (DHT). However, scientific studies have not confirmed a direct link between creatine and hair loss. The most cited study, conducted in 2009, found that creatine supplementation increased DHT levels in rugby players. However, increased DHT does not necessarily correlate to hair loss, as it highly depends on each individual. Most research on this topic indicates that creatine does not significantly contribute to hair thinning or male pattern baldness, and more extensive studies are needed to draw definitive conclusions.

How Creatine Works: The Science Behind It
Creatine’s main function in the body is to replenish ATP, the primary energy currency used during short bursts of intense exercise. When you engage in activities like sprinting or lifting weights, your muscles use ATP for energy. However, the body’s ATP stores deplete quickly, usually within 10-15 seconds of intense activity. Creatine helps regenerate ATP by donating a phosphate group, allowing you to maintain power output for longer periods.
Additionally, creatine promotes an anabolic environment due to its ability to retain fluid inside muscle cells. This increase in intracellular water volume can lead to improved protein synthesis and muscle growth.
How Much Creatine Should You Take and When?
For the best results, creatine supplementation typically follows a two-phase process:
- Loading Phase (Optional): Take 20 grams of creatine per day (divided into 4 doses) for 5-7 days. This helps saturate your muscles with creatine more quickly.
- Maintenance Phase: After the loading phase, take 3-5 grams per day to maintain elevated creatine levels.
Alternatively, you can skip the loading phase and simply take 3-5 grams per day, though it may take longer (around 3-4 weeks) to achieve the same muscle saturation.
Creatine can be taken at any time during the day, though many prefer post-workout, as it may enhance recovery when combined with carbohydrates and protein.
Creatine Non-Responders: Why Some Don’t See the Benefits
While most people experience improvements with creatine supplementation, there are some individuals known as “non-responders.” These people may not see the same strength or performance gains despite taking creatine. This could be due to genetic factors, as the body’s baseline creatine levels may already be optimal, making further supplementation less effective. Non-responders make up a small percentage of the population, but they exist.
Creatine in Food: Is It Enough?
You can obtain creatine from foods like meat and fish, but it would take a lot of food to match the dose you’d get from supplementation. For example, you’d need to eat about 2 kilograms (4.4 lbs) of beef or 1.5 kilograms (3.3 lbs) of salmon to get the equivalent of 5 grams of creatine—the recommended daily dose. This is why supplementation makes sense for those seeking to maximize the benefits of creatine without consuming excessive amounts of meat.
